Today’s show sees Riley interviewing Dan Vernon. Dan is a professional photographer who is best known for his work covering the NN Running Team. Dan talks about what it’s like to shoot the biggest moments in marathoning, and shares some great stories about spending time in training camps in Africa. Running under quarantine with Luke Mathews and Sean Whipp: In episode one, our host and TEMPO editor Riley Wolff gives some insight on Gen Gregson’s record-breaking run at the Tan – including how it all came together and how it went down on the day. Our special guest this week is Luke Mathews. Riley chats with the 800m and 1500m star about the highs and lows of his career so far, what it’s like to sign a professional contract and how his training is impacted by current coronavirus restrictions.
